Linear Frequency Modulation Continuous Wave (LFM-CW) Miniature InSAR system mounted on small aircrafts like unmanned aerial vehicles (UAVs), suffers from considerate trajectory and attitude deviations. The trajectory and attitude deviations are mainly caused by aircraft´s light weight and low flight height. Moreover, we cannot implement a highaccuracy inertial measurement unit (IMU) which is too heavy beyond the aircraft´s carrying capacity. In this paper, we have proposed a motion compensation scheme for LFM-CW Miniature InSAR system mounted on small aircrafts. Experimental results are presented to demonstrate effectiveness of our proposed motion compensation scheme.
